What is a digital QR menu?
A digital QR menu is simply your list of dishes and prices in web format. Customers scan a QR code with their phone camera and see your menu directly in their browser. No app download required.
Key benefits
- Contactless — More hygienic for your customers
- Instant updates — Change a price and it updates immediately
- No printing costs — No need to reprint every time you make changes
- Works on any phone — No app required
